Iraqis want elections without delay.

In a recent poll 80.5% of Iraqis showed that they want elections to be held at time without any delay. The poll that was conducted by Al Sabah center for public opinion studies showed also that 15% were with delaying the elections while 4% did not have any opinion.

The poll took the opinions of 850 citizens of Baghdad from different ethnic, social and religious groups who were selected according to the simple random sample method. 40% of those were women.
Among those who favored delaying the elections 3% wanted the elections to be delayed for 6 months, 8% demanded a postponement for 1 year or more while 4% didn’t specify a period.
From Al Sabah.
